Fine-tune your skills to meet today's digital video challenges. The all-new Third Edition of Video Engineering, by Arch Luther and Andrew Inglis, gives you instant access to formats, standards and technology for capturing, storing, editing, transmitting and reproducing all kinds of video. From cutting-edge digital postproduction technology to streaming video on the Internet, this desktop database of essential video knowledge puts your professional career in high gear! You'll master the techniques required for flawless operation of next-generation technology, including: digital HDTV; computer & internet video formats; digital cameras and recorders; receivers and monitors; CATV & satellite TV systems; and more.

Rating: 4 out of 5 stars - An excellent resource
The subject matter is presented in superb technical detail, but in a straight-ahead style that should be readily understood by any reader with a good grounding in basic electronics. The emphasis is on what the equipment does and why; and although there are no schematics or discussions of particular circuit details, this information is readily available from other sources and its omission is not a flaw in the case of this book.
